SMU President Calls Proposed G.W. Bush Library a “Boon” That Would Increase National Visibility

From the news wires:

Calling concerns about building George W. Bush’s presidential library there unfounded, Southern Methodist University’s president told faculty Wednesday the project would increase the school’s visibility nationwide….”Over time, the political components of the library complex will fade and the historical aspects will ascend,” Turner told 175 of the 600-member faculty at their spring meeting….Wednesday’s meeting came about a week after a Faculty Senate meeting in which some professors raised concerns about the library — everything from whether it would be a terrorist target to whether fundraising would hurt SMU’s centennial campaign.
